Choosing the Right Location

The first step to off-grid living is choosing the right location. There are a few things to consider when making your decision, including:

  • Climate: You'll want to choose a location with a climate that is conducive to your lifestyle. If you're planning on growing your own food, you'll need to make sure the climate is suitable for the plants you want to grow.
  • Water: Access to water is essential for survival. You'll need to make sure your location has a reliable source of water, such as a well, spring, or river.
  • Land: You'll need enough land to build a home, grow food, and raise animals. The amount of land you need will depend on your lifestyle and needs.
  • Security: You'll want to choose a location that is safe and secure. You should consider factors such as crime rates, natural disasters, and political stability.

Building a Sustainable Home

Once you've chosen a location, the next step is to build a sustainable home. Your home should be designed to meet your needs and lifestyle, while also being environmentally friendly.

There are many different types of sustainable homes to choose from, including:

  • Earthen homes: Earthen homes are made from natural materials, such as earth, straw, and clay. They are energy-efficient and durable, and they can be built relatively inexpensively.
  • Log homes: Log homes are made from logs that have been harvested from sustainable forests. They are strong and durable, and they can provide a cozy and rustic living space.
  • Strawbale homes: Strawbale homes are made from bales of straw that have been plastered with a mixture of clay and sand. They are energy-efficient and affordable, and they can create a unique and beautiful living space.
  • Passive solar homes: Passive solar homes are designed to take advantage of the sun's energy to heat and cool the home. They feature large windows on the south side of the home, and they are often built with thermal mass materials, such as concrete or stone, to absorb and release heat.

Growing Your Own Food

Growing your own food is an essential part of off-grid living. You'll be able to save money, eat healthier, and be more self-sufficient.

There are many different ways to grow food, including:

  • Gardening: Gardening is a great way to grow your own vegetables, fruits, and herbs. You can grow a garden in a backyard, on a rooftop, or even in a container.
  • Farming: Farming is a larger-scale operation than gardening. You can farm on a piece of land, or you can lease land from a farmer.
  • Foraging: Foraging is the practice of gathering wild plants and fruits. Foraging can be a great way to supplement your diet and learn about the plants in your area.

Raising Animals

Raising animals can be a great way to provide yourself with food, milk, and eggs. You can also raise animals for companionship and protection.

There are many different animals that you can raise, including:

  • Chickens: Chickens are a good choice for beginners because they are relatively easy to care for. They can provide you with eggs and meat.
  • Goats: Goats are good for milk and meat. They are also good at clearing land.
  • Pigs: Pigs are good for meat and lard. They can also be used to clear land.
  • Cows: Cows are good for milk and meat. They can also be used to pull carts or plows.

Storing Water

Storing water is essential for survival. You'll need to have a way to store water for drinking, cooking, and bathing.

There are many different ways to store water, including:

  • Water tanks: Water tanks are a good way to store large amounts of water. They can be made from a variety of materials, such as plastic, metal, or concrete.
  • Rain barrels: Rain barrels collect rainwater from your roof. They are a good way to save money on your water bill.
  • Wells: Wells are a good way to access groundwater. They can be dug by hand or by a well driller.
  • Springs: Springs are a natural source of water. They can be found in many areas, and they can provide a reliable source of water.

Essential Survival Techniques

In addition to the basics of off-grid living, you'll also need to learn some essential survival techniques. These techniques will help you to survive in the wilderness if you ever get lost or stranded.

Some of the most important survival techniques include:

  • Starting a fire: Starting a fire is essential for warmth, cooking, and signaling for help.
  • Purifying water: Purifying water is essential for survival. You can purify water by boiling it, filtering it, or using a water purification tablet.
  • Navigating in the wilderness: Navigating in the wilderness is essential for finding your way back to civilization. You can navigate by using a map and compass, or by using natural landmarks.
  • Hunting and fishing: Hunting and fishing are essential for providing yourself with food in the wilderness.
  • Building a shelter: Building a shelter is essential for protection from the elements.
